Ewing Honored for Community Stewardship Efforts

Ewing Receives Community Stewardship Award for Outreach and Volunteerism Ewing Irrigation and Landscape Supply's vice president of sustainability Warren Gorowitz accepts the Community Stewardship Award on July 20, 2015.

The National Association of Landscape Professionals presented Ewing with its Community Stewardship Award for years of commitment to giving back to the community.

July 31, 2015, PHOENIX, Ariz.—Ewing has been awarded the Community Stewardship Award for its ongoing culture of giving back within the community, sponsored by the National Association of Landscape Professionals (NALP). This award recognizes NALP member companies and organizations that have demonstrated leadership through their dedication and contribution to the good of the community. Winners were recognized at the NALP’s Renewal & Remembrance/Legislative Day on the Hill Banquet Dinner on July 20.

“We look for opportunities to partner with organizations that share our core values of water efficiency, sustainability, wellness and family,” said Douglas York, president of Ewing Irrigation and Landscape Supply.

“Our involvement in service projects allows us to build camaraderie and help boost awareness of the Green Industry—and the many ways in which we (as landscape professionals) enhance the lives of individuals every day where they live, work and play.”

Some companywide projects have included:

  • A total renovation of a military family’s backyard and irrigation system for the PLANET Day of Service.
  • Four regional projects conducted concurrently to complete landscape renovations benefiting Desert Open Space Sustainable Education Center (Mesa, Ariz.), Loaves & Fishes Edible Landscape (Sacramento, Calif.), Housing Hope (Everett, Wash.), and SpiritHorse Therapeutic Riding Facility (Corinth, Tex.).
  • A complete baseball field renovation by 350 employees for Sunshine Acres, a children’s home that provides emotional, social, physical, educational and spiritual support for children that are separated from their parents.
  • A campus wide renovation project for St. Philip The Apostle Catholic School completed by 300 employees with projects including a total field renovation, construction of community garden beds, paver patio installation with lighting and outdoor sound, and complete irrigation system repairs and retrofits.

Ewing Community Outreach In January 2014, Team Ewing surpassed its goal of raising $25,000 for Autism Speaks, with runners raising $30,000 and Ewing donated an additional $20,000, for a total of $50,000 to Autism Speaks, bringing the total to over $200,000 since 2009.

In addition to these projects, employees fundraised over $200,000 for Autism Speaks, allowing them the opportunity to share the culture of giving back with others outside the company.

The York family’s commitment to helping others has been demonstrated by our companywide projects and fundraising efforts, and that commitment has encouraged employees to get involved in their local communities. From building dog beds for a local animal shelter to donating products and installing synthetic turf for a family in need, Ewing employees are helping their local communities across the U.S.

NALP (formerly PLANET) is the voice of 100,000 landscape and lawn care industry professionals who create and maintain healthy green spaces, advocating on issues impacting its members and offering mentoring and education programs that inspire its members to excellence. Many members become Landscape Industry Certified, achieving the highest standard of industry expertise, business professionalism and knowledge.
